Transaction 61e38c53b8a9cd43dd49aa3014e640401697161baf30c9a2e2b7aef5b5ea8fa3

2 Input
2 Outputs
  • 61e38c53b8a9cd43dd49aa3014e640401697161baf30c9a2e2b7aef5b5ea8fa3:0
  • value  308289
    address  3ALGj594g85rc44QHY4TnRqtPXrpFsAt68
  • 61e38c53b8a9cd43dd49aa3014e640401697161baf30c9a2e2b7aef5b5ea8fa3:1
  • value  997441
    address  3EvwjpwfsdRhuTdtAeUWr61RUJq7HU65GY